ホームページ  >  記事  >  データベース  >  PostgreSQL から MySQL にデータを移行するにはどうすればよいですか?

PostgreSQL から MySQL にデータを移行するにはどうすればよいですか?

Susan Sarandon
Susan Sarandonオリジナル
2024-11-09 00:15:02435ブラウズ

How to Migrate Data from PostgreSQL to MySQL?

PostgreSQL から MySQL へのデータ移行

質問:

PostgreSQL データベースから MySQL にデータを転送するにはどうすればよいですか?データベース?

回答:

データベースを PostgreSQL から MySQL に移行するには、pg2mysql ツールを利用できます。

pg2mysql:

pg2mysql は、PostgreSQL から MySQL へのデータベース移行に特化したオープンソースのコマンドライン ユーティリティです。これは、2 つのデータベース間でデータを転送するための効率的かつ信頼性の高い方法を提供します。

インストール:

まず、次のコマンドを使用してシステムに pg2mysql をインストールします。

pip install pg2mysql

使用法:

pg2mysql を使用してデータベースを移行するには、次の手順に従います:

  1. PostgreSQL データベースへの接続を確立します。
  2. PostgreSQL データベースのダンプを作成します:
pg_dump -U <username> -d <database_name> -f dump.sql
  1. MySQL データベースへの接続を確立します。
  2. PostgreSQL ダンプを MySQL にインポートします:
mysql -u <username> -p <database_name> < dump.sql

代替オプション (2019 年更新):

pg2mysql で問題が発生した場合は、https:// で入手可能なフォークされたバージョンの使用を検討できます。 github.com/oberon00/pg2mysql。このフォークはパッチと簡単なメンテナンスを提供しており、元の pg2mysql ツールで発生したいくつかの問題に対処できる可能性があります。

以上がPostgreSQL から MySQL にデータを移行する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。